Здравствуйте.
Настраиваю маршрутизацию на Solaris 10(машина х86).
Проблема в следующем: после перезагрузки сервака вся маршрутизация пропадает.Как сделать, чтобы она не пропадала?
мои действия:
маршрут по умолчанию 172.16.7.254
айпишник сервера 172.16.7.32(имя flexmul2)ifconfig bge0 plumb
ifconfig bge0 172.16.7.32 netmask 255.255.255.0 broadcast + up
route add default 172.16.7.254
файл hosts:
127.0.0.1 localhost
172.16.7.32 flexmul2.deltatel.ru flexmul2 loghost
172.16.7.34 omp-2
172.16.10.99 dtw2-3
файл hostname.bge0
flexmul2
файл defaultrouter:
172.16.7.254
файл netmasks:
172.16.7.0 255.255.255.0До перезагрузки:
//netstat -rRouting Table: IPv4
Destination Gateway Flags Ref Use Interface
-------------------- -------------------- ----- ----- ------ ---------
172.16.7.0 flexmul2 U 1 2 bge0
default 172.16.7.254 UG 1 4
localhost localhost UH 29 6776 lo0после перезагрузки:
//netstat -rRouting Table: IPv4
Destination Gateway Flags Ref Use Interface
-------------------- -------------------- ----- ----- ------ ---------
localhost localhost UH 29 6776 lo0Подскажите плз. почему пропадает маршрутизация?
>localhost
>localhost
> UH 29
>6776 lo0
>
>Подскажите плз. почему пропадает маршрутизация?интерфейс bge0 после перезагрузки поднимается? автоматом?
С указанным ip и прочими бантиками?
Посмотри нет ли проблем с демонами:
svcs -xv
>интерфейс bge0 после перезагрузки поднимается? автоматом?
>С указанным ip и прочими бантиками?
>Посмотри нет ли проблем с демонами:
>svcs -xvИнтерфейс bge0 после перезагрузки не поднимается, каждый раз приходится поднимать его вручную. Автоматом поднимается только lo0
С демонами все ок
10:27:04 //svcs -xv
svc:/application/print/server:default (LP print server)
State: disabled since Wed Jul 01 16:23:09 2009
Reason: Disabled by an administrator.
See: http://sun.com/msg/SMF-8000-05
See: man -M /usr/share/man -s 1M lpsched
Impact: 2 dependent services are not running:
svc:/application/print/rfc1179:default
svc:/application/print/ipp-listener:default
10:36:56 //В консоли вроде не ругается.
Сервак ругается после перезагрузки, вот вырезка из /var/adm/messages:
Jul 2 10:46:03 flexmul2 ipf: [ID 774698 kern.info] IP Filter: v4.0.3, running.
Jul 2 10:46:04 flexmul2 gda: [ID 243001 kern.info] Disk1: <Vendor 'Gen-ATA ' Product 'ST3160827AS '>
Jul 2 10:46:04 flexmul2 ata: [ID 496167 kern.info] cmdk1 at ata2 target 1 lun 0
Jul 2 10:46:04 flexmul2 genunix: [ID 936769 kern.info] cmdk1 is /pci@0,0/pci-ide@1f,2/ide@0/cmdk@1,0
Jul 2 10:46:13 flexmul2 mac: [ID 846399 kern.info] NOTICE: bge0/0 unregistered
Jul 2 10:46:13 flexmul2 bge: [ID 801725 kern.info] NOTICE: bge0: bge_rem_intrs
Jul 2 10:46:23 flexmul2 pseudo: [ID 129642 kern.info] pseudo-device: devinfo0
Jul 2 10:46:23 flexmul2 genunix: [ID 936769 kern.info] devinfo0 is /pseudo/devinfo@0
Вот сообщения после того, как я прописываю дефолт рут и bge0 вручную:
Jul 2 10:47:40 flexmul2 bge: [ID 801725 kern.info] NOTICE: bge0: ddi_intr_get_supported_types() returned: 3
Jul 2 10:47:40 flexmul2 bge: [ID 801725 kern.info] NOTICE: bge0: Using Legacy interrupt type
Jul 2 10:47:40 flexmul2 bge: [ID 801725 kern.info] NOTICE: bge0: bge_add_legacy_intrs
Jul 2 10:47:40 flexmul2 unix: [ID 954099 kern.info] NOTICE: IRQ23 is being shared by drivers with different interrupt levels.
Jul 2 10:47:40 flexmul2 This may result in reduced system performance.
Jul 2 10:47:40 flexmul2 mac: [ID 543131 kern.info] NOTICE: bge0/0 registered
Jul 2 10:47:45 flexmul2 bge: [ID 801725 kern.info] NOTICE: bge0: link up 100Mbps Full-Duplex (initialized)Есть у кого какие-то идеи?
>Jul 2 10:47:40 flexmul2 bge: [ID 801725 kern.info] NOTICE: bge0: bge_add_legacy_intrs
>
>Jul 2 10:47:40 flexmul2 unix: [ID 954099 kern.info] NOTICE: IRQ23 is
>being shared by drivers with different interrupt levels.
>Jul 2 10:47:40 flexmul2 This may result in reduced system performance.
>Какая то фигня с прерываниями.
Что у тебя за машина? В смысле кто производитель?Возможно если ты пошаманишь с прерываниями в BIOS (у тебя кажись x86?) то что заработает ...
Но тут я уже не при делах - все что вы делаете, вы делаете на свой страх и риск ... (с)
Глянь в /var/adm/messages - есть какие либо ошибки?
Процесс загрузки ОС погляди - может он ругается на что нить в консоли.
>Глянь в /var/adm/messages - есть какие либо ошибки?
>Процесс загрузки ОС погляди - может он ругается на что нить в
>консоли.Машина у меня х86.
в /var/adm/messages ошибок нет, как и в консоли он ни на что не ругается. Попробую соляру переустановить, может это поможет.
Спасибо за советы
Пропиши имя хоста в /etc/nodename
>
>
>Пропиши имя хоста в /etc/nodenameПрописано:((
Попробую соляру переустановить, может поможет
>>
>>
>>Пропиши имя хоста в /etc/nodename
>
>Прописано:((
>Попробую соляру переустановить, может поможетПереустановка соляры помогла - ошибка заключалась в том, что когда я устанавливал ее первый раз, на вопрос сетевой это сервер или нет(networked or not networked), я ответил нет, когда отметил сервер, как сетевой, все заработало.
Всем спасибо за помощь в решении проблемы.